WakeUpWalMart.com is launching a new community campaign to kick off our second year that will bring together supporters from local communities. We are calling them “WakeUps.”

Once a month, on the first Wednesday of every month, supporters will gather in communities across the country to talk about the latest Wal-Mart news, build support for our campaign, and take action to change Wal-Mart.

What Does it take to become a Local WakeUp Leader?
WakeUp leaders are changing Wal-Mart by agreeing to:

  1. Participate in a monthly conference call with other leaders from around the country;
  2. Lead one meeting and one action per month;
  3. Use the WakeUpWalMart.com website to publicize your meetings and update your group’s profile.
To help make your local WakeUp a success, the WakeUpWalMart.com national field office will provide:
  1. A monthly conference call to help you plan your meetings and actions;
  2. Flyers and other materials for your meetings and actions – available on a special section of the WakeUpWalMart.com website and one packet mailed to you per month prior to the monthly meetings;
  3. Help with recruiting members for your group and reaching out to local press;
  4. A web site for WakeUp community groups where you can easily post meetings, see members of the group, run a discussion and receive up-to-date national information on the campaign.
